Acute tubular necrosis (ATN) is a medical condition involving the death of tubular epithelial cells that form the renal tubules of the kidneys. ATN presents with acute kidney injury (AKI) and is one of the most common causes of AKI. Common causes of ATN include low blood pressure and use of nephrotoxic drugs.

Acute tubular necrosis (ATN) is the most common cause of acute kidney injury (AKI) in the renal category (that is, AKI in which the pathology lies within the kidney itself). The term ATN is actually a misnomer, as there is minimal cell necrosis and the damage is not limited to tubules.
Postrenal acute renal failure occurs because of urinary tract obstruction (5 to 10 percent of cases). The most commonly encountered diagnoses are prerenal acute renal failure and acute tubular necrosis (a type of intrinsic acute renal failure).
The two major causes of AKI that occur in the hospital are prerenal disease and acute tubular necrosis (ATN). Together, they account for approximately 65 to 75 percent of cases of AKI. (See 'Frequency of prerenal disease and acute tubular necrosis as a cause of AKI' below.)
Acute tubular necrosis is usually diagnosed by a nephrologist (kidney specialist). The diagnosis is mainly clinical but can be guided by microscopic examination of your urine. A biopsy of the kidney tissue can be done in certain cases, especially when the diagnosis is uncertain.

ATN may be classified as either toxic or ischemic. Toxic ATN occurs when the tubular cells are exposed to a toxic substance (nephrotoxic ATN). Ischemic ATN occurs when the tubular cells do not get enough oxygen, a condition that they are highly sensitive and susceptible to, due to their very high metabolism.

ATN must be differentiated from prerenal azotemia because treatment differs. In prerenal azotemia, renal perfusion is decreased enough to elevate serum blood urea nitrogen (BUN) out of proportion to creatinine, but not enough to cause ischemic damage to tubular cells.
Acute tubular necrosis is kidney injury caused by damage to the kidney tubule cells (kidney cells that reabsorb fluid and minerals from urine as it forms). Common causes are low blood flow to the kidneys (such as caused by low blood pressure), drugs that damage the kidneys, and severe bodywide infections.

This is the official exact match mapping between ICD9 and ICD10, as provided by the General Equivalency mapping crosswalk. This means that in all cases where the ICD9 code 584.5 was previously used, N17.0 is the appropriate modern ICD10 code.
